When I first moved to Williamsburg, Brooklyn, I was obsessed with Dumont. I found their 10 dollar burger a special treat, and I would treat myself to the burger quite often. After a while they expanded their business to the adjoining store front to include a larger delivery service, and with the expansion came an increase in their prices. They now offer a burger for $12.50, and a mini burger for $9.50. I began to frequent less and less, and hadn’t eaten there in a year or so, when I decided to return for a burger last week.

It is a very good burger, not my favorite by any stretch, but a good hearty treat.

I like the wood decor and cozy setting. They have communal tables and bar seating. The best thing about this place though: the mac and cheese. Few things are as indulgent and satisfying. I also opted to try the pumpkin shake with a shot of booze and it was delicious as well.

The mini burger was plenty for me – about 6 ounces, plus more room for the mac.
